Microwave spectroscopy of high-L helium Rydberg states: 10H-10I, 10I-10K, and 10K-10L intervals

Fine-structure intervals separating the 10H(L = 5), 10I(L = 6), 10K(L = 7), and 10L(L = 8) states of helium have been measured precisely, using a fast-beam microwave--laser resonance technique. The results: 10H-10I, 157.0508(26) MHz; 10I-10K, 60.8152(18) MHz; and 10K-10L, 27.1835(63) MHz agree well with theoretical predictions which include contributions due to ''retardation'' or ''Casimir'' forces.
